Instructions

How to diagnose this issue safely

Useful tools
  • Bright flashlight
  • Known-working wall outlet
  • Clean dry lint-free cloth
Before you begin
  • Power the vacuum off, disconnect its charger, and remove a detachable battery only when the exact owner guide describes that action.
  • Use only owner-access points and maintenance actions documented for the exact machine code.
  • Do not charge a swollen, cracked, leaking, wet, unusually hot, or impact-damaged battery.
  • Do not open the charger, battery cells, or charging electronics, splice its cable, or bridge charging contacts.
  1. Confirm the Omni-glide configuration

    Omni-glide (SV19) is a bagless cordless body with a wand and powered cleaner head fitted to this machine. Cataloged variants include Omni-glide, Omni-glide+. The verified owner-service profile identifies it as the Dyson Omni-glide multi-directional hard-floor cordless platform. Match the machine code and serial label before ordering a filter, bin, wand, cleaner head, battery, or charger; a retail family name can cover incompatible hardware.

  2. Identify the exact direct charger

    Confirm the outlet works, then inspect the external plug, adapter, cable, connector, wall cradle where fitted, and matching wall charger and vacuum charging inlet or dock for damage, liquid, debris, heat, or discoloration. Use only the direct charger specified for the exact machine code.

  3. Clean and reseat dry connections

    With the charger unplugged, remove dry debris from the connector and inlet. User-removable click-in battery slides from the handle and charges directly or on the dock; the complete pack remains sealed. Reseat the click-in battery pack only if it is owner-removable, then reconnect the matching direct charger.

  4. Read the documented indicator

    Allow the machine and battery to reach normal room temperature. Record the exact light pattern, screen message, or app message and compare it with the exact owner guide; do not guess from another Dyson generation's indicator pattern.

  5. Replace only confirmed charging hardware

    If testing isolates the external charger or adapter, replace the complete sealed assembly listed for the exact machine. Do not splice a cable, open a mains adapter, substitute a similar connector, or treat a battery, dock, or charge-port failure as a direct-charger repair.
